Fabio Capello hails "incredible" World Cup

Russia manager Fabio Capello hails the "incredible" quality of this year's World Cup.

Russia manager Fabio Capello has hailed the "incredible" quality of this year's World Cup.

The tournament has been praised by many for the attacking nature of football that has been played, with 136 goals scored in the group stage.

"In my career, I've never seen a World Cup at this level," Capello told FIFA.com.

"The quality is absolutely incredible, the pace is so intense. This is a great tournament. If you make the slightest mistake, you pay for it."

Russia failed to make it through to the knockout stages, after being held to a 1-1 draw by Algeria in their final Group H match.
